Class: Aws::Pinpoint::Types::SMSChannelResponse

Inherits:
Struct
  • Object
show all
Includes:
Structure
Defined in:
lib/aws-sdk-pinpoint/types.rb

Overview

Provides information about the status and settings of the SMS channel for an application.

Constant Summary collapse

SENSITIVE =
[]

Instance Attribute Summary collapse

Instance Attribute Details

#application_idString

The unique identifier for the application that the SMS channel applies to.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#creation_dateString

The date and time, in ISO 8601 format, when the SMS channel was enabled.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#enabledBoolean

Specifies whether the SMS channel is enabled for the application.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#has_credentialBoolean

(Not used) This property is retained only for backward compatibility.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#idString

(Deprecated) An identifier for the SMS channel. This property is retained only for backward compatibility.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#is_archivedBoolean

Specifies whether the SMS channel is archived.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#last_modified_byString

The user who last modified the SMS channel.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#last_modified_dateString

The date and time, in ISO 8601 format, when the SMS channel was last modified.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#platformString

The type of messaging or notification platform for the channel. For the SMS channel, this value is SMS.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#promotional_messages_per_secondInteger

The maximum number of promotional messages that you can send through the SMS channel each second.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#sender_idString

The identity that displays on recipients’ devices when they receive messages from the SMS channel.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#short_codeString

The registered short code to use when you send messages through the SMS channel.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#transactional_messages_per_secondInteger

The maximum number of transactional messages that you can send through the SMS channel each second.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end

#versionInteger

The current version of the SMS channel.



10679
10680
10681
10682
10683
10684
10685
10686
10687
10688
10689
10690
10691
10692
10693
10694
10695
10696
# File 'lib/aws-sdk-pinpoint/types.rb', line 10679

class SMSChannelResponse < Struct.new(
  :application_id,
  :creation_date,
  :enabled,
  :has_credential,
  :id,
  :is_archived,
  :last_modified_by,
  :last_modified_date,
  :platform,
  :promotional_messages_per_second,
  :sender_id,
  :short_code,
  :transactional_messages_per_second,
  :version)
  SENSITIVE = []
  include Aws::Structure
end